From: Andy Green Date: Wed, 19 Jul 2017 06:19:03 +0000 (+0800) Subject: coverity 181574: confirm uri_ptr non-null before deref X-Git-Tag: accepted/tizen/4.0/unified/20171012.191640~37 X-Git-Url: http://review.tizen.org/git/?p=platform%2Fupstream%2Flibwebsockets.git;a=commitdiff_plain;h=1690581cd2c39645f87ccd1552c22c209ee20f3e coverity 181574: confirm uri_ptr non-null before deref --- diff --git a/lib/server.c b/lib/server.c index 668f6f1..69b0e8a 100644 --- a/lib/server.c +++ b/lib/server.c @@ -777,7 +777,7 @@ lws_http_action(struct lws *wsi) /* we insist on absolute paths */ - if (uri_ptr[0] != '/') { + if (!uri_ptr || uri_ptr[0] != '/') { lws_return_http_status(wsi, HTTP_STATUS_FORBIDDEN, NULL); goto bail_nuke_ah;